8 Industry-Rocking Recruitment News Stories to Sink Your Teeth Into this Week – 20th June 2016

Social Talent

In recruitment news this week: Microsoft Buy LinkedIn for $26 BILLION. In a statement on their official blog , LinkedIn CEO Jeff Weiner says; “We are joining forces with Microsoft to realise a common mission to empower people and organisations”. LinkedIn’s CEO Jeff Weiner will report to Microsoft CEO, Satya Nadella.

Tips For Creating a Passive Candidate Pool

JazzHR

LinkedIn Talent blog contributor Jenny Jedeikin recommended that hiring managers make non-requisition calls to candidates to pique their interest. The Society for Human Resource Management reported that referrals are employers’ top source for new hires, accounting for 30 percent of all hires in 2016.
